Hear Chris Stapleton, Snoop Dogg & Cindy Blackman Santana’s New Monday Night Football Theme

In The Air Tonight

Chris Stapleton and Snoop Dogg are taking football to new heights with their cover of “In the Air Tonight,” the new theme for Monday Night Football.

The dynamic duo, joined by drummer Cindy Blackman Santana, teamed up to put a unique twist on Phil Collins’ classic hit, and it’s set to be the new anthem for Monday Night Football.

Their cover of “In the Air Tonight” takes the hauntingly atmospheric original and infuses it with a fresh, modern twist. The blend of Chris’s bluesy guitar licks and Snoop’s signature flow adds layers of depth and intrigue to this iconic track, making it the perfect anthem to kick off Monday Night Football.

This unexpected collaboration generated immense buzz after it debuted during last night’s Monday Night Football broadcast, which saw the Pittsburgh Steelers score the win over the Cleveland Browns 26-22.
